Full Job Description
Job Purpose

Create an environment that inspires and engages the branch team to deliver results. Accountable for the successful execution of safe and profitable branch operations, business strategy, customer service, and consistent compliance with MRC procedures and controls.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ities (not all inclusive)

Individual must be able to perform the essential duties with or without reasonable accommodation.

  • Engage employees in understanding, ownership, and compliance with all safety guidelines, drive a rigorous approach to the identification and correction of hazards, evaluation of risks, and implementation of prevention and control measures.
  • Ensure all required incident reporting is performed in a timely manner using the appropriate process.
  • Oversee the implementation of corrective measures arising from incident investigation and hazard reports.
  • Prepare the branch budget and monitor expenditures to ensure compliance.
  • Monitor work flows throughout the branch to ensure timely accomplishment of sales, service, warehouse, and logistics duties.
  • Ensure cycle count programs are executed according to plan.
  • Lead employees to anticipate and solve problems and plan for workload changes.
  • Motivate and challenge employees and encourage growth and development.
  • Set clear expectations and measure results, communicate consistently, provide timely, candid feedback, and hold people accountable.
  • Identify and initiate or obtain training required for employee success in performing duties.
  • Maintain confidential information pertaining to normal supervisory duties.
  • Administer, communicate, and promote awareness and compliance with MRC policies, procedures, and expectations to all employees, including strict enforcement and compliance with DOT and SOX compliance guidelines.
  • Develop annual branch business plans to ensure the development of current business and the addition of new business.
  • Control, perform or oversee inside and outside sales activities including customer service, purchasing, inventory control, shipping and receiving, or support to sales personnel.
  • Research and develop information on new projects.
  • Develop new business, utilize and partner with regional and corporate resources and sales teams to identify and drive growth in key markets.
  • Tailor branch strategy to ensure alignment with National Accounts service, support, and strategic needs.
  • Identify and implement solutions to customers' needs.
  • Develop and maintain standards of service that deliver unbeatable excellence.
  • Communicate honestly and consistently to reaffirm MRC's reputation for ethical and dependable partnerships.
  • Establish a friendly and effective working relationship with customers and internal partners through in-person visits, written and verbal correspondence, and other effective interpersonal skills.
  • Keep management informed of the area's performance and provide advice on those matters that are mutually pertinent.
  • Manage confidential information appropriately, including pricing and contract information, resale costs, and expense items.
  • Carry out other duties within the scope, spirit, and purpose of the job.

About MRC Global

MRC Global is a distributor of pipes, valves, fittings, and other products used in the energy industry. The company was founded in 1921 and is headquartered in Houston, Texas. MRC Global operates in more than 25 countries and has over 400 service locations worldwide. The company's products are used in a variety of industries, including oil and gas, chemical, and power generation.
